Nanotech opens door to future of insulin medication

Phys.org 

An international team, led by researchers from Australia, have developed a system using nanotechnology that could allow people with diabetes to take oral insulin in the future. The researchers say the new insulin could be eaten by taking a tablet or even embedded within a piece of chocolate.

Researcher: Climate models can run for months on supercomputers—but my new algorithm can make them ten times faster

Phys.org 

Climate models are some of the most complex pieces of software ever written, able to simulate a vast number of different parts of the overall system, such as the atmosphere or ocean. Many have been developed by hundreds of scientists over decades and are constantly being added to and refined. They can run to over a million lines of computer code—tens of thousands of printed pages.

Beautifully crafted Roman dodecahedron discovered in Lincoln—but what were they for?

Phys.org 

Roman dodecahedra are something of an enigma: there is no known mention of these 12-sided, hollow objects in ancient Roman texts or images. First discovered in the 18th century, around 130 dodecahedra have been found across the Roman Empire, although it is interesting that the majority have been found in northern Europe and Britain, and none have been found in Italy.

When injecting pure spin into chiral materials, direction matters

Phys.org 

Researchers from North Carolina State University and the University of Pittsburgh studied how the spin information of an electron, called a pure spin current, moves through chiral materials. They found that the direction in which the spins are injected into chiral materials affects their ability to pass through them. These chiral "gateways" could be used to design energy-efficient spintronic devices for data storage, communication and computing.
